## Changelog — FareSpinner pricing experiment

Heads up, support crew: we rotated the key that signs the FareSpinner ticket-pricing experiment configs. Old bundles will show a stale-signature warning until tonight's sync — totally expected, no need to escalate. The variant split (40/60) is unchanged, so pricing questions stay the same. For verifying new bundles, use the key below.

deploy key for kafof-kaguf: bky9_WnPyu8S2E

CI note: Marrowbus broker upgrade hiccups

Support folks — after the Marrowbus upgrade to 7.x, consumers may briefly report duplicate deliveries while partitions rebalance. That's expected for about ten minutes post-deploy. If it persists, check whether the pipeline actually picked up the new broker image. The image build we verified is listed below.

build token for kagaf-hahof: htk14_9d3d4d26d7d8de

**Break-Glass Access: Fieldlark Offline Mode**

Hey plugin authors! Fieldlark's offline mode caches survey layers locally so crews in the Dunmare highlands can keep mapping without signal. Normally your plugin syncs through the standard queue — but if the sync broker is down and a crew is stranded mid-survey, there's a break-glass path that force-unlocks the local cache for direct writes. Use it sparingly; everything gets flagged for audit. To trigger the break-glass unlock, enter the passphrase below.

unlock words, hahip-baduf: holwyn-istath-julvan